What Are Chinos Trousers?
Chinos are slim-fitted, lightweight trousers traditionally made from cotton or cotton blends, designed for durability and flexibility. Originally inspired by military uniforms, chinos come in a variety of colors beyond the classic khaki—think navy, olive, black, and even bold tones—offering endless styling possibilities.

Why Ladies Are Obsessed with Chinos Trousers
Chinos have become a go-to for modern women because they strike the perfect balance between formal and casual. They’re easier to mix and match than formal suits, more comfortable than jeans, and infinitely more polished than everyday denim. Plus, a well-fitted pair elevates any outfit effortlessly—making chinos a timeless investment.
How to Choose the Perfect Chinos for Your Figure
1. Fabric Matters
Opt for 100% cotton, cotton blend, or stretch cotton for breathability and flexibility. Lightweight chinos are ideal for spring and summer, while heavier fabrics offer warmth for cooler seasons.

2. Fit is Key
A tailored yet comfortable fit flatters every body shape. Look for:
- Slim or tailored silhouette for precision and elegance
- Relaxed fit for a laid-back, flattering look
Avoid overly baggy styles, which can drag on the thighs.
3. Color and Pattern
Neutral tones like khaki, navy, or charcoal are year-round essentials. Experiment with subtle patterns—chamois, herringbone, or pinstripes—for added sophistication.
Styling Chinos Trousers Like a Pro
1. Workwear Revival
Pair charcoal chinos with a crisp button-down shirt tucked neatly in, a tailored blazer, and loafers or structured heels. Roll the cuffs just above the cuff for polished detail.
2. Casual Chic
Opt for a pastel or neutral pair with a fitted cropped sweater, a slouchy knit top, and ankle boots or chic sneakers. Add a structured crossbody bag for a modern edge.
3. Evening Elegance
Switch to a deeper navy or black chinos, layered neatly under a longline blazer or tailored minidress. Elevate with statement jewelry—a bold necklace or delicate bangles—and pointed-toe pumps.
4. Layering Doesn’t Have to Be Complicated
Chinos play well with oversized blazers, cropped jackets, or cropped wool coats. Layer wisely—keep silhouettes clean to maintain sharpness.
